Why Choose a Digital LCD Manometer?

Digital manometers with LCD screens provide instant, unambiguous readings, eliminating the parallax errors common with analog dials. The 2.5-inch display size offers an excellent balance between portability and readability, even in low-light conditions. Key advantages include high accuracy, user-selectable units (PSI, Bar, kPa, etc.), and additional features like data hold, MAX/MIN recording, and low battery indicators.

Core Features and Functionality

A high-quality 2.5″ LCD Display Manometer is more than just a screen. Look for robust features such as IP-rated water and dust resistance for harsh environments, durable polymer or metal cases, and reliable sensor technology. Many models offer auto-power-off to conserve battery life and peak hold functions to capture transient pressure spikes, making them indispensable for system diagnostics and maintenance.

Applications Across Industries

These versatile tools are critical in HVAC for checking refrigerant and gas pressures, in automotive for fuel and oil systems, in manufacturing for pneumatic control, and in water treatment for pump and filter monitoring. Their digital precision ensures systems operate within safe and efficient parameters, preventing downtime and costly failures.

How to Select the Right Model for Your Needs

Selection starts with understanding your requirements. Determine the required pressure range, media compatibility (will it measure air, oil, water, or refrigerant?), and necessary accuracy class. Consider the physical connection type (bottom or back) and the operating environment – will it need to be intrinsically safe or withstand vibration? Finally, evaluate the value of added data-logging capabilities or connectivity for your workflow.

Frequently Asked Questions (FAQ)

Q: How do I calibrate a 2.5″ LCD manometer?
A: Most digital models have a calibration function accessible via a menu. It’s best to use a certified pressure reference and follow the manufacturer’s specific instructions for accurate calibration.

Q: Can it measure both positive and negative pressure?
A> Many digital manometers are compound gauges, capable of measuring both vacuum and positive pressure. Always check the specified range (e.g., -30 to +30 PSI) before purchasing.

Q: What is the typical battery life?
A> With standard alkaline batteries and auto-shutoff, a quality manometer can last for hundreds of hours of active use. An LCD screen is very energy-efficient compared to backlit displays.
